Understanding Skin Tags and Their Causes

Approximately 50% of adults will develop skin tags by age 60, highlighting their commonality. We’ve assisted over 200 clients in Lakeland, Florida with concerns about these benign growths, often leading to unnecessary worry.

Many people mistakenly believe that skin tags indicate a serious health issue, but in reality, they are typically harmless. This misconception can lead to costly and unnecessary medical treatments, costing clients upwards of $2,500 if they pursue removal options without first consulting a professional.

Common causes and risk factors for skin tags include:

  • Age: Skin tags are more prevalent in older adults.
  • Obesity: Overweight individuals are at a higher risk.
  • Genetics: Family history can play a significant role.

  • Skin tag size: Larger tags may require surgical removal, while smaller ones can often be treated with cryotherapy.
  • Location matters: Tags in high-friction areas may heal more slowly.
  • Health conditions: Pre-existing health issues can result in longer healing times.

Signs that your skin tags may require urgent attention include:

  • Rapid growth or changes in size
  • Bleeding or discharge
  • Severe pain or irritation

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I remove skin tags at home?

While some attempt to remove skin tags at home, it is risky and can lead to infections; consulting a professional is the safest option.

What is the cost of skin tag removal in Lakeland?

The cost of skin tag removal in Lakeland typically ranges from $100 to $500, depending on the method and number of tags removed.

Are skin tags a sign of something serious?

Skin tags are generally benign, but any sudden changes in appearance should be evaluated by a professional for safety.

How can I prevent skin tags from forming?

Maintaining a healthy weight and proper skin care can help reduce the likelihood of developing skin tags.

What should I do if a skin tag gets irritated?

If a skin tag is irritated, it’s best to consult a professional to avoid complications and receive appropriate treatment.
